Last week the Minnesota Vikings had a bye. Their 2007 record stands at 1-3. The Vikings tam leaders include; quarterback Kelly Holcomb completing 35 passes on 67 attempts for 427 yards with one touchdown, running back Adrien Peterson leads in rushing with 76 carries for 383 yards with one touchdown and Bobby Wade leads in receiving with 15 receptions for 173 yards. During week five the Chicago Bears beat the Green Bay Packers 27-20 to improve to a 2-3 season record. The Bears 2007 team leaders include; quarterback Brian Griese completing 49 passes on 77 attempts for 500 yards with four touchdown, Cedric Benson leads in rushing with 101 carries for 303 yards and Bernard Berrian leads in receiving with 25 receptions for 330 yards. Last season the Bears finished first in the NFC North conference with a 13-3 record. They clinched the division and had homefield advantage through out the playoffs.
